comparemela.com

Top Locations Tagged with Crave Food Dog

Crave Food Dog in United States - 23059/Restaurant near Hanover

1). Crave Fro Yo Cafe

Crave Food Dog in United States - 53010/Bar near Fond Du Lac

2). Crave

3). Crave, E Main St

vimarsana © 2020. All Rights Reserved.